Output 38b53f16fd6a6d7e8af97493fda4f43ea8af5cde5104cfc295a3b0044d21ab18:2

value
29544512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47a7b284dedbf716ef805a10d015a1957cea11d8 OP_EQUAL
address
MES36sA83cGTmsVoaaMCsZr6pbGskg9Ynm
transaction
38b53f16fd6a6d7e8af97493fda4f43ea8af5cde5104cfc295a3b0044d21ab18
spent
true